OK, dumb thing to do, lesson learned. Our last ride in this area
was the end of October, and we had rain. After returning home, I
began the repacking and winter sorting. I use Rubbermaid containers in my 
trailer to store several items. While looking
for something today, I find one of the containers has ice drops
all over the inside of it, from condensation. Lesson: don't put
wet things in a sealed container! The odor is what first caught
my attention-rotten milk? My red hay bag is in need of a Nair
treatment, it is covered with fuzzy white mold. The other two
items faired better, bale bags, so now everything is out to dry.
Glad it wasn't important "tack" items...whew.
